Inspecting and Reinforcing Metal Structures

The first step in preparing your home for winter is to inspect existing metal structures. Look for signs of wear and tear, such as rust, corrosion, or loose fittings. Addressing these issues promptly can prevent further damage during winter storms.

Reinforcing metal structures, like fences and railings, ensures they remain sturdy against winter winds and snow accumulation. Consider consulting with a professional metal fabricator to assess and reinforce weak points.

Optimizing Metal Roofing for Winter

Metal roofing is a popular choice for its durability and ability to shed snow efficiently. To prepare for winter, ensure your metal roof is free of debris and check for any leaks or gaps that could allow moisture penetration. Applying a weather-resistant coating can enhance its performance and longevity.

Installing Snow Guards

Snow guards are essential for metal roofs in snowy regions. They prevent large amounts of snow and ice from sliding off all at once, which can be dangerous. Properly installed snow guards protect both your property and the people around it.

Enhancing Metal Gutters and Downspouts

Functional gutters and downspouts are crucial for directing melted snow away from your home's foundation. Ensure they are free of blockages and securely attached. Metal fabrication can help in customizing gutter systems to better handle heavy snowfall and prevent ice dams.

Adding Heating Elements

Consider adding heating elements to gutters and downspouts to prevent ice buildup. These systems can melt snow directly, ensuring water flows smoothly and reducing the risk of damage.

Securing Metal Doors and Window Frames

Metal doors and window frames provide robust insulation against the cold. Inspect these elements for gaps or drafts and apply weather stripping or sealants as needed. Well-sealed frames help maintain indoor warmth and reduce energy costs.

Upgrading to thermally broken metal frames can further improve insulation efficiency, offering additional protection during the colder months.
